• Methodology based on Eurocodes and analysis of discontinuous MEF model is presented.
• Eurocodes reliability criterion and classical limit analysis approach are combined.
• Methodology allows checking all the ultimate limit states in any design situation.
• Ultimate limit states of SEQ, with sliding between blocks, STR and SBC are analyzed.
• Collapse progress can be predicted in case that the structure loses the stability.
This work proposes a methodology, based on finite element simulation, for analyzing masonry historical structures, according to Eurocodes, that has been applied for the assessment of the Saint Sebastian church, located in Piedratajada (Zaragoza, Spain). Settlement pathologies were detected and the aim of the work is to verify the current safety level and to propose reinforcement solutions if necessary. Results confirm the effect of soil settlement and allow establish the maximum admissible value. If that value is reached, a couple of reinforcement solutions, installing sheets of steel or carbon fiber composite, are proposed and analyzed.
